Hagan Scholarship 

The Hagan Scholarship is a nationwide need-based merit scholarship, providing recipients with the opportunity to graduate college debt-free.  The scholarship provides up to $7,500 each semester for up to eight consecutive semesters.   For more information  you can visit the website at www.hsfmo.org or visit the guidance office.  The deadline to submit is December 1, 2023.
